Subtract 30/21 from 70/12
1st number: 5 10/12, 2nd number: 1 9/21
70/12 - 30/21 is 185/42.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 21 is 84
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 84 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 7 = 84,
70/12 = 70 × 7/12 × 7 = 490/84 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 21 × 4 = 84,
30/21 = 30 × 4/21 × 4 = 120/84 - Subtract the two like fractions:
490/84 - 120/84 = 490 - 120/84 = 370/84 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 185/42
- In mixed form: 417/42
